Output cf75d2d6cd8321d470d1bca233a4faa6674007dc1b01aee564407316de7ed010:1

value
766455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e026e5e9b93901e16327f40a005c503ab8a34b3c OP_EQUAL
address
3N8DtCcKDkg25pa8A48Pi3cNKMPwLTn21c
transaction
cf75d2d6cd8321d470d1bca233a4faa6674007dc1b01aee564407316de7ed010
confirmations
255008
spent
true